Minnesota's Liam Robbins: Won't play Saturday

Rotowire ·

Robbins (ankle) will be unavailable for Saturday's game against Rutgers, Marcus Fuller of the Minneapolis Star Tribune reports.

Analysis:

Robbins is set to miss his fourth straight game due to a lingering ankle injury that he suffered in a game against Purdue on Feb. 11. The 7-0 junior initially attempted to try and play through the pain but it caused him to have some of his most unproductive stat lines of the season and he now appears to potentially be in danger of missing the Gophers' Big Ten Tournament game on Wednesday. Eric Curry should continue to remain in the starting lineup while Robbins is sidelined.
